PVC is a inherently unstable polymer that degrades when exposed to heat, light, and mechanical stress. Stabilizers are added to prevent this degradation, and Calcium Zinc Stabilizers represent a significant advancement in this field. They are a harmonious blend of calcium and zinc compounds, which work together to neutralize the harmful byproducts of PVC degradation. Unlike lead-based stabilizers, they are non-toxic and environmentally friendly, aligning with global health and safety regulations. This makes them particularly valuable for applications such as food packaging, medical devices, and children's toys. The benefits of using Calcium Zinc Stabilizers extend to processing efficiency and product performance. They offer excellent thermal stability, allowing PVC to be processed at higher temperatures without degradation, which can lead to faster production cycles and reduced energy consumption. Furthermore, they provide effective lubrication, both internally and externally, which aids in melt flow and prevents sticking to processing equipment. This dual action of thermal stabilization and lubrication is a key advantage. Manufacturers looking for an effective heat stabilizer for rigid PVC will find these compounds to be highly beneficial.
In terms of final product characteristics, Calcium Zinc Stabilizers contribute significantly to durability and longevity. They enhance weatherability, protecting PVC from UV radiation and environmental aging, thus preventing discoloration and material breakdown. This makes them ideal for outdoor applications like window frames, pipes, and roofing. They also improve the mechanical properties of PVC, such as impact strength and tensile strength, ensuring that the products can withstand physical stress.
